GB/T 29732-2013 Surface chemical analysis.Medium resolution Auger electron spectrometers.Calibration of energy scales for elemental analysis (English Version)
This standard specifies the calibration method for the Auger electron spectrometer when the kinetic energy scale uncertainty is 3 eV, and is used to identify conventional elements on the surface. In addition, a method for determining the calibration cycle is also specified. This standard applies to instruments with direct mode or differential mode resolution less than or equal to 0.5%, and the peak-to-peak modulation amplitude of the differential mode is 2 eV. This standard applies to spectrometers equipped with an inert gas ion gun or other sample cleaning methods with an electron gun of 4 keV or higher beam energy.
